Artist Statement
Taking a pause from the hustle and bustles of today’s urban mindset, Margarita Cajumban is inspired by a bygone era. This young artist imagines an idyllic Filipiniana world where Hispanic houses, kalesas, traditional markets, and children’s games co-exist. She paints life as she imagined it would have been, or maybe even, can still be. Without the modern trappings, her scenes of minute pointillism details on bright vibrant color fields evoke a certain innocence in youthful optimism and joy.
Cajumban (1994) is from Paete, Laguna.
This is part of Qube Gallery at Crossroads’ Young Artist series.
